Today, according to 1 Thessalonians 3:13, the Bible says, “May He strengthen your hearts so that you will be blameless and holy in the presence of our God.” You may ask, “How can I be called a blameless and holy person before our God? How can God see my life and call me holy and blameless? How can it be possible?”
The Bible says that God found Noah to be a righteous man. God found Job to be a man of integrity, blameless before the Lord. If they received such a name, we can also, my friends, by the grace of God. But how can we be holy and blameless when, in our work, each of us has a boss? We do things to please our boss so that he sees us doing the right things and is happy with us. We come to work on time, follow all the rules, and make sure that the work we do is successful. When we take it to our boss, he is happy with the work we have done. Seeing him happy about us makes us feel so fulfilled. We think, “Oh, the boss has said a good word about me. He has said, ‘Well done.’” That gives us great joy.
It is the same when we are working for our Lord Jesus. I need to make sure that the Lord says, “Well done” to me. That fear of God is so important. I know it is very hard when we are doing it for God because, much more than our boss, His expectations are so high. He wants us to do great things. He wants our life to be perfect. But my friends, that fear of God—that I should please Him, that I should do the right thing before Him by shunning away all evil and fulfilling His will—is very important. When you have that fear of God to be holy and blameless, God will perfect His strength in every area of your life. God will perfect His anointing in your weaknesses, and He will start operating through you. The only thing that He sees is our heart.
Do you desire to live a righteous life and accomplish the purposes God has planned for you? When your heart is willing to obey Him, He will equip you with everything you need. His grace will enable you to overcome your limitations, and He will work through your life to accomplish His will. As you depend on Him, He will guide your steps and help your life become a testimony of His righteousness. As this verse says, “May He strengthen your hearts so that you will be blameless and holy before Him.”
